Free Tax Prep with CA$H Greater Portland |
Did your household earn $64,000 or less in 2023? Get your taxes done for FREE with CA$H Greater Portland, an initiative of United Way of Southern Maine. Last year, taxpayers in Cumberland County saved $122,304 in tax preparation fees by preparing their taxes with CA$H Greater Portland. CA$H offers four easy and convenient ways to file. See which one works best for you at uwsme.org/free-tax-prep.

WOMEN UNITED MAKES HOLIDAYS BRIGHTER |
Women United recently hosted their annual drive for winter gear and holiday gifts benefiting single mothers and their children in partnership with the giving circle’s community partners.
Tracey Williams, ‘MomCore’ Family Coach at York County Community Action Corporation, shared a story of a mother who had survived domestic abuse and is still learning to survive daily. Because of the abuse, she and her children have not been able to celebrate Christmas for a long time. This season, they did, and Women United helped contribute to her new beginning. |
